2026年终极AI编程指南:Aider + DeepSeek-R1 开启高逻辑终端工作流
2026年终极AI编程指南:Aider + DeepSeek-R1 开启高逻辑终端工作流
在 2026 年的今天,AI 辅助编程已经从简单的代码补全演变为复杂的“自主代理”时代。如果你还在依赖传统的 IDE 插件进行碎片化的代码编写,那么你可能正在错过一场效率革命。目前,最受顶级开发者青睐的组合莫过于 Aider AI 终端编码器 与 DeepSeek-R1 推理模型 的强强联手。

为什么是 Aider + DeepSeek-R1?
1. 从“系统1”到“系统2”的逻辑飞跃
早期的 AI 编程工具(如 2024 年之前的版本)大多采用“系统1”思维:反应快、直觉强,但容易产生幻觉。当你要求它重构整个微服务时,它往往会顾此失彼。
而 DeepSeek-R1 引入了“系统2”推理架构(Thinking-before-speaking)。在输出代码前,它会模拟运行结果、检查逻辑矛盾并自我修正。配合 Aider 强大的多文件管理能力,这种组合能够处理横跨数百个文件的复杂重构,而不会丢失上下文。
2. 极致的成本优势
在 2026 年,高逻辑推理不再是奢侈品。DeepSeek-R1 提供的逻辑推理能力媲美顶级模型(如 Claude 3.5 Opus),但价格却低了近 90%。这意味着“持续重构”——让 AI 代理全天候清理技术债务——在经济上变得完全可行。
Aider 的核心架构解析
Aider 不仅仅是一个聊天框,它是一个 local-first 的编码代理。其架构分为四个关键层:
- 模型层 (Model Layer): 负责推理的 LLM(如 DeepSeek-R1 或 Claude 3.5)。
- 编排层 (Orchestration Layer): 管理工作流、状态和工具访问。
- 存储层 (Memory Layer): 通过 Repo Map (代码库地图) 压缩整个项目的结构,让 AI 理解类继承和函数依赖。
- 接口层 (Interface Layer): 极简的终端界面,直接与 Git 集成。

实战指南:手把手教你配置“主权编程堆栈”
想要在终端开启高逻辑工作流,只需以下几个步骤:
第一步:环境准备
确保你安装了 Python 3.10+。通过 pip 安装 Aider:
pip install -U aider-chat
第二步:配置 API
为了实现最佳的“主权工作流”,建议使用 OpenRouter 或私有端点。设置你的环境变量:
export OPENROUTER_API_KEY="your_key_here"
第三步:启动架构师模式 (Architect Mode)
这是 Aider 2026 年最强大的功能。它将过程分为“规划”和“执行”:
aider --model openrouter/deepseek/deepseek-r1 --architect
- 规划者 (Planner): DeepSeek-R1 分析请求并创建逻辑蓝图。
- 执行者 (Editor): 像 Claude 3.5 Haiku 这样轻量快捷的模型负责编写实际的代码差异 (Diffs)。

2026 编程工具大横评
如果你还在犹豫,不妨看看目前主流 AI 编程工具的对比:
| 工具 | 核心优势 | 目标用户 | 价格 | | :--- | :--- | :--- | :--- | | Aider | 终端原生、Git 集成、多文件专家 | 资深开发者、架构师 | 开源/按量付费 | | Cursor | AI 原生 IDE、Agent 工作流 | 全栈开发、团队协作 | $20/月 | | GitHub Copilot | 生态集成最强、代码补全之王 | 微软生态用户 | $10/月 | | Zemith | 25+ 多模型切换、一站式工作空间 | 研究员、全能型开发者 | $14.99/月 | | Cline | 开源 IDE 代理、高度隐私控制 | 隐私敏感型开发者 | 免费 (自备 Key) |

案例研究:50 个 React 文件迁移至 Next.js
一家中型初创公司最近面临从 Create React App (CRA) 到 Next.js 16 的整体迁移。高级工程团队最初预计需要 4 周 时间。
使用 Aider + DeepSeek-R1 的方案:
- Skeleton 阶段: Aider 自动生成
app/目录并映射路由。 - Logic 阶段: DeepSeek-R1 识别哪些组件应设为 Server Components,哪些保留为
use client。 - State 阶段: 自动将 Redux 样板代码重构为更简洁的 Zustand 模式。
最终结果: 整个过程仅用时 3 天,Token 总成本不到 $5.00,效率提升了 13 倍。
专家提示与最佳实践
- 性能优化: 简单的任务使用 GPT-4o Mini,复杂的重构务必开启 DeepSeek-R1 的架构师模式。
- 安全性: 在 OpenRouter 设置中关闭“数据训练”开关。如果条件允许,可以在 24GB VRAM 的显卡上通过 Ollama 本地运行 DeepSeek-R1 (32b)。
- Repo Map 调优: 将
map-tokens设置为 1024 或更高,确保 AI 能“看到”大型单体仓库中的完整符号图。

结语
AI 革命正在重塑开发者的定义。在 2026 年,平庸的编码者将被淘汰,而能够熟练驾驭 Aider + DeepSeek 等顶级工具的“主权开发者”将拥有不可逾越的竞争优势。
现在就开始: 选一个你手头最头疼的 Bug 或重构任务,让 Aider 试试看吧!
觉得这篇教程有用吗?欢迎分享给你的开发者朋友,并在下方评论区留下你的 AI 编程心得!